    I came across an article about an extremely wide-spread problem impacting multiple generations of iPhones. The problem is said to involve ‘uninstalled apps’ that despite being ‘uninstalled’ are still consuming sometimes VERY hefty loads of data transmission. The article goes on to say that Apple has been aware of the issue for some time but has yet to give any clear explanations let alone probable dates of solution…
